The Social Health Authority has debunked claims that some hospitals have yet to receive payments from the authority.

In a statement on Wednesday, August 20, SHA relayed that so far, Ksh3.4 billion has been disbursed to all contracted facilities countrywide.

This Ksh3.4 billion had been disbursed to fund claims for inpatient care, drugs and substance abuse cover, mental wellness, critical care, and surgeries. "The Social Health Authority (SHA) has disbursed KES 3.4 billion to health facilities nationwide for Social Health Insurance Fund (SHIF) claims for inpatient care, drugs and substances abuse cover, mental wellness, critical care, and surgeries," the statement read in part.
